Why study this course? You can tailor the course to fit your needs, aspirations, and interests. With the latest Adobe software, DSLRs, lighting as well as professional darkroom facilities, Kenton is the ideal place to develop advanced photography skills. What interests should you have? A creative and curious mind with an interest in visual culture and art. The motivation to learn and try out new skills. What will the course cover? • Skills such as manual camera settings • Studio lighting • Lenses • Photoshop editing • Procreate® • Darkroom processes and alternative processes • Art history • Building a portfolio
The minimum course entry requirement to follow a Level 3 programme is five 9-4 GCSEs. Grade 5 in Photography/Art.
Component 1: Personal investigation portfolio and essay - 60%. Component 2: Externally set assignment: 40%.
